Getting Around the Belle Isle Neighborhood in Detroit, MI

Walk Score®

8 / 100

Car-Dependent

Almost all errands require a car

Bike Score®

33 / 100

Somewhat Bikeable

Minimal bike infrastructure

Transit Score®

26 / 100

Some Transit

A few nearby public transportation options

Frequently Asked Questions about Belle Isle Apartments with Washer/Dryer

What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Belle Isle?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Belle Isle with Washer/Dryer is at Village Park Apartments listed at $810.

How much is the average rent for Belle Isle Apartments with Washer/Dryer?

The average rent for a Apartment in Belle Isle with Washer/Dryer is $1,197.

What is the largest Belle Isle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?

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Belle Isle is a 1,237 square feet unit starting from $1,300 at Grayhaven Marina Village.

What is the average size for Belle Isle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?

The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Belle Isle is currently at 686 sq ft.
